The Anchor Line originally served as offices for the Anchor Line shipping company, transporting passengers and cargo to North America. Completed in 1875, the building’s stonework and ceilings reflect the wealth of the era. The interior has been restored, retaining stained glass and mosaic tiling, aiming to evoke a luxurious transatlantic ocean liner.
